php5.3以后的版本连接sqlserver2000的方法


Posted in PHP onJuly 28, 2014

最近在做一个系统要抓取管家数据库里面的几个表的数据显示在web页面,于是乎上网搜了一下php如何连接sqlserver2000数据库,网上很多教材都是要配置php.ini配置文件,去掉;extension=php_mssql.dll前面的分号”;”,然后把ext文件里面php_mssql.dll复制粘贴到系统盘system32目录下,然后重启apache服务器即可,然后写连接数据库的代码件:<?php $conn=mssql_connect(“服务器”,”数据库用户名”,”数据库密码”); mssql_selected(‘”对应数据库名字”,$conn);?>服务器一般书写格式为“ip,端口号”如何是本机,可以写成为localhost,端口或者127.0.0.1,端口.至于怎么写根据自己的情况书写,特此声明以上连接sqlserver数据库仅限php版本是5.3一下的。如果你是5.3以上的版本以上连接亦不可用,因为php5.3以上版本微软已不支持。下面讲解一下php5.3以上版本如何连接sqlserver2000或者以上版本数据库。

那么php5.3以上版本如何连接sqlserver数据库呢?因为这个我也查找了很多资料,有说下载驱动的,可驱动只是针对sqlserver2005或者2008数据库版本,而对于sqlserver2000版本微软也并未提供相关支持驱动,至少我没有找到,好了闲话少说,还是赶紧介绍一下我的php5.3以上版本连接sqlserver2000的方法吧。其实很简单了就是用odbc连接2000数据库。下面直接说下步骤,首先需要配置数据源,打开控制面板,找到管理工具,打开管理工具,,然后双击打开数据源(ODBC),

php5.3以后的版本连接sqlserver2000的方法选择系统DSN,然后点击添加

php5.3以后的版本连接sqlserver2000的方法选择sql server,然后下一步,当然如果你是其他数据库比如access那么你选择acess先关的驱动了。

php5.3以后的版本连接sqlserver2000的方法名称一定要写,是你写代码连接访问数据库的必备参数。服务器也一定要选择,如果是本机器就选择local,如果是其他机器就选择那个可看到的名字。

php5.3以后的版本连接sqlserver2000的方法

登陆ID一定要写,就是访问你数据库的名字,密码也是访问数据库的密码,如果有就写,没有就空着,然后一直下一步知道完成为止,然后测试连接,如果点击测试连接提示成功那么恭喜你,你的php5.3以上版本连接sqlserver2000就成功了,那么下一步就是书写连接数据库的代码了。

下面直接附上我写的代码,以供大家参考:

<?php

$conn=odbc_connect(“刚才配置的数据源名字”,”访问数据库名字”,”访问数据库密码”);
$sql=”select * from 表名”;
$exec=odbc_exec($conn,$sql);//执行语句
while(odbc_fetch_array($exec))
{

$abc=odbc_result($exec,'”数据表对应字段名字”);
echo $abc
…
}

希望这篇文章对需要的朋友有所帮助,可以说这篇文章是我自己总结出来的,查找了很多资料,应该说是目前最详细的php5.3以上版本连接sqlserver2000的文章了。

PHP 相关文章推荐
树型结构列出指定目录里所有文件的PHP类
Oct 09 PHP
解决phpmyadmin 乱码,支持gb2312和utf-8
Nov 20 PHP
简化php模板页面中分页代码的解析
Feb 06 PHP
PHP输出时间差函数代码
Jan 28 PHP
获取php页面执行时间,数据库读写次数,函数调用次数等(THINKphp)
Jun 03 PHP
php中用socket模拟http中post或者get提交数据的示例代码
Aug 08 PHP
PHP管理依赖(dependency)关系工具 Composer 安装与使用
Aug 18 PHP
PHP实现支持加盐的图片加密解密
Sep 09 PHP
PHP版单点登陆实现方案的实例
Nov 17 PHP
php封装json通信接口详解及实例
Mar 07 PHP
PHP微信发送推送消息乱码的解决方法
Feb 28 PHP
关于PhpStorm设置点击编辑文件自动定位源文件的实现方式
Dec 30 PHP
php中把美国时间转为北京时间的自定义函数分享
Jul 28 #PHP
php的mkdir()函数创建文件夹比较安全的权限设置方法
Jul 28 #PHP
php中error与exception的区别及应用
Jul 28 #PHP
浅析get与post的一些特殊情况
Jul 28 #PHP
thinkphp学习笔记之多表查询
Jul 28 #PHP
CMS中PHP判断系统是否已经安装的方法示例
Jul 26 #PHP
PHP中file_exists函数不支持中文名的解决方法
Jul 26 #PHP
You might like
异世界新番又来了,同样是从零开始,男主的年龄降到5岁
2020/04/09 日漫
php 特殊字符处理函数
2008/09/05 PHP
深入php函数file_get_contents超时处理的方法详解
2013/06/03 PHP
PHP使用自定义方法实现数组合并示例
2016/07/07 PHP
Yii框架的redis命令使用方法简单示例
2019/10/15 PHP
取得传值的函数
2006/10/27 Javascript
JS 时间显示效果代码
2009/08/23 Javascript
juqery 学习之四 筛选查找
2010/11/30 Javascript
window.event快达到全浏览器支持了,以后使用就方便了
2011/11/30 Javascript
ExtJs纵坐标值重复问题的解决方法
2014/02/27 Javascript
利用CSS3在Angular中实现动画
2016/01/15 Javascript
基于原生JS实现图片裁剪
2016/08/01 Javascript
Vue组件BootPage实现简单的分页功能
2016/09/12 Javascript
AngularJS实现根据变量改变动态加载模板的方法
2016/11/04 Javascript
jquery对所有input type=text的控件赋值实现方法
2016/12/02 Javascript
微信小程序中使元素占满整个屏幕高度实现方法
2016/12/14 Javascript
bootstrap模态框远程示例代码分享
2017/05/22 Javascript
关于vue 项目中浏览器跨域的配置问题
2020/11/10 Javascript
探究Python的Tornado框架对子域名和泛域名的支持
2015/05/02 Python
Django中模版的子目录与include标签的使用方法
2015/07/16 Python
Python实现PS图像调整之对比度调整功能示例
2018/01/26 Python
python框架flask入门之路由及简单实现方法
2020/06/07 Python
Python结合Window计划任务监测邮件的示例代码
2020/08/05 Python
css3 实现元素弧线运动的示例代码
2020/04/24 HTML / CSS
美国波道夫·古德曼百货官网:Bergdorf Goodman
2017/11/07 全球购物
HTC VIVE美国官网:VR虚拟现实眼镜
2018/02/13 全球购物
Lookfantastic意大利官网:英国知名美妆购物网站
2019/05/31 全球购物
印尼购物网站:iLOTTE
2019/10/16 全球购物
编码实现字符串转整型的函数
2012/06/02 面试题
请写出char *p与"零值"比较的if语句
2014/09/24 面试题
毕业生造价工程师求职信
2013/10/17 职场文书
纪念九一八爱国演讲稿600字
2014/09/14 职场文书
2014年实习生工作总结
2014/11/27 职场文书
给老婆道歉的话
2015/01/20 职场文书
大学生自荐信范文
2015/03/05 职场文书
分家协议书范本
2016/03/22 职场文书